PROGRAMA/OBJECTIVOS: This is a practical course designed for Portuguese actors auditioning for English speaking roles. It is aimed at providing Portuguese actors with the tools to help them feel more at ease when auditioning in English. It will include a casting simulation, presentation and practice of typical questions the actor needs to ask and answer in the audition interview, talking about professional biography, breaking down an English text for meaning, pronunciation, stress and intonation and, most importantly, practice in delivering a text in English. Actors will be “coached” by trainers using English dialogues and texts, as well as being expected to learn a short audition piece in English to present to the class.

AMANDA BOOTH
Amanda Booth has lived in Portugal for many years. She has a long experience of teaching English which includes several courses specifically designed for Portuguese students attending the Curso de Formaçâo Profissional de Actores at ACT. As an actress she has performed English theatre in a variety of venues in Portugal as well as performing translated pieces written by Portuguese playwrights in the UK . She worked for SIC, RTP and RDP for a number of years as a voice over, presenter and translator. At present her work consists of English voiceovers, translations and voice coaching for public speaking events as well as voice direction for animated film and audio CDs for Portuguese school children learning English .
